WebNov 7, 2024 · This is the weight of a cut of one meter of this fabric, so you have to take its width into account. To find the weight in g/m² from the weight in glm, you simply have to divide the latter by the width of the fabric in meters, for instance for this wool coating with a width of 140 cm and a weight of 476 glm: 476 / 1.40 = 340 g/m².

Chino (237-339 gsm) – A definite medium-heavy weight fabric that is usually woven in a twill weave and used to create ‘chino’ trousers. citizens bank international limited nepalWebOct 26, 2024 · For example, the standard thickness for rayon thread would be referred to as 40 wt thread. A 20 wt thread would be thicker, and a 60 wt thread would be finer. When choosing thread weight, it all depends on the desired result or purpose of your project. It was developed in France in the 1890s and was originally called “artificial silk.”. In 1924, the term rayon was officially adopted by the textile industry. Unlike most man-made fibers, rayon is not synthetic.
